@@paulashton7207 Tommy has a recent video with Rick Beato where he talks about practicing a song so obsessively that he can forget all about how he's _playing_ it and can focus completely on how the song _feels_ . That's the level of dedication it takes to be able to truly interpret a song in the perfect way in any given moment. He says it's not even music to him until he has completely mastered the skill of playing the song, which is necessary before he can start playing it his way, with his own personality and feel.
